The turning point in Millers life occurred in January 2015 when she was sexually assaulted by Brock Turner behind a dumpster at Stanford University. The case that followed was a media circus, and during the sentencing hearing in 20 Judge Aaron Persky handed down a sentence of just six months in county jail, citing the potential impact of a prison term on the perpetrators education. The outrage was immediate and global. What captured the public imagination as much as the crime itself was the victim impact statement read in court by Miller, written under the pseudonym "Emily Doe." In it, she masterfully articulated the trauma, the violation, and the lifelong repercussions of the assault, turning her from a anonymous victim into a powerful voice for survivors everywhere. The statement was later published anonymously in the New York Times and formed the basis of her 2019 memoir, "Know My Name," which debuted at number one on the New York Times bestseller list.

The financial realities of his chosen path were harsh. While his son Robert Jr. was ascending to become one of the world's highest-paid actors, the elder Downey operated in the realm of low-budget, personal projects. Films like *Greaser's Palace* (1972), a bizarre and hilarious Western reimagining of the life of Christ, and *The Prisoner of Second Avenue* (1975), a sharp and painful examination of suburban despair and unemployment, showcased his talent but rarely translated into significant box office returns. His struggle was emblematic of the independent filmmakers dilemma: creating meaningful, challenging art in a system designed to reward the safe and the sensational. He was a pioneer of the underground film movement, a movement that often left its pioneers without a financial safety net. For many years, the narrative surrounding Robert Downey Sr. was not one of a massive net worth but of a talented man fighting to keep his creative head above water in an indifferent industry.
